Náhodou jsem si všiml, že je tomu přesně rok, co bylo spuštěno sledování sledování počtu zobrazení stránek, založené na doplňku Count Views. Jaké jsou výsledky?

Zde je seznam nejnavštěvovanějších 10 stránek, resp. příspěvků Blogu:

(aktuální stav je k dispozici v postranním panelu)

Na prvním místě je bezkonkurenčně Blog, což se dá logicky zdůvodnit tím, že je nejvíce propagovanou částí webu a současně to souvisí i s tím, že pod tímto odkazem se skrývá veškerý výpis článků bez ohledu na zadané parametry (stránkování, štítky, období apod.) či jejich kombinaci. Následuje domovská stránka, která oproti Blogu vykazuje méně než pětinovou návštěvnost. Pak jsou zde již příspěvky blogu a stránky v řádu stovek návštěv. Nejlépe dopadl shodou okolností dříve článek týkající se parametrů, ze stránek pak byly nejvíce navštěvovány Kontakty a Tipy a Triky, což je celkem pochopitelné. Jako kuriozitu uvádím, že se do top desítky dostal článek Grav CMS bude od příští verze výhradně s databází, který je trochu specifický 🙃.

Doplněno 23. 3. 2022: Pro zajímavost uvádím ještě aktuální stav zobrazení chybové stránky Error 404, který činí 1825. Zda se jedná o překlepy v adresách nebo chybné odkazy mi není známo, ale pravděpodobně to bude zapříčiněno jedním z uvedeného. Pokud interně měním odkazy, tak vždy zajistím přesměrování původních na nové. Pouze výjimečně stránku trvale vymažu, resp. znepřístupním.

Je důležité uvést, že se nejedná o unikátní přístupy, ale o celkový počet zobrazení stránek (při každém načtení stránky se přičte jednička). Jedná se tedy o skutečně orientační čísla, určená spíše pro doporučení potenciálně zajímavého příspěvku dle jeho návštěvnosti, než pro nějaké statistické účely. Obecně řečeno, uvedená služba neumí kontrolovat unikátnost, což je ale problém i u dalších CMS a nejen v případě měření návštěvnosti (namátkou vzpomeňme ankety, formuláře atd.). Možná řešení navíc narážejí na legislativní překážky, např. použití cookie (s rozumnou dobou exspirace, nicméně pokud ji uživatel nepovolí, popř. vymaže, tak věc stejně neřeší), logování IP adresy (zde pro změnu narážíme na problém, pokud z jedné IP adresy přistupuje více uživatelů), session aktuálního uživatele atd., popř. jejich vzájemná kombinace (ať již AND nebo OR). Dále je vhodné měřit, resp. filtrovat data pouze ze stanoveného časového úseku, což v tomto případě také nelze. Data jsou uložena v rámci yaml souboru ve formátu cesta: počet, jakákoliv separace je tedy zpětně nemožná.

Mám v úmyslu vytvořit doplněk, který omezení použitého doplňku Count Views, resp. podobného doplňku Views (který na rozdíl od přechozího ukládá data do databáze SQLite, nicméně opět souhrnně), jehož autorem je přímo Team Grav, bude řešit, ale to až někdy v neurčené budoucnosti.

Předchozí příspěvek Následující příspěvek